Baralaba, QLD
Baralaba is located 146 kilometres south west of Rockhampton, off the Capricorn Highway. Baralaba is a small town in the heart of the farming and cattle district. The Dawson River flows through the town and great fishing can be enjoyed. There is a historical village to visit, a Farm Stay where horseriding is available, water sports on the river and a golf course, tennis courts and bowling green. The Baralaba Show is held in the first week of May, there is also an annual Art exhibition held in the town.
